What consequences can the falsification of a non-criminal record certificate have in Mexico?

Falsifying a non-criminal record certificate in Mexico can have serious legal consequences. Forgery of documents is a crime and can result in criminal charges. Additionally, if the false certificate is used to obtain employment, benefits or improper advantages, the person may face legal action and loss of employment opportunities.

What is the role of the Superintendency of Banking, Insurance and AFP (SBS) in preventing money laundering in Peru?

The Superintendency of Banking, Insurance and AFP (SBS) in Peru is the regulatory and supervisory body of financial entities, insurance companies and pension fund administrators. In preventing money laundering, the SBS plays a fundamental role by establishing regulations, issuing directives and monitoring compliance of entities under its jurisdiction. In addition, it works in collaboration with the FIU and other authorities to strengthen measures to prevent and detect money laundering in the financial sector.

What is the situation of the rights of workers in the oil sector in Venezuela?

The rights of oil sector workers in Venezuela have faced various challenges, including job insecurity, lack of job security, and political interference in unions. The economic crisis and poor management of the oil industry have led to wage cuts, mass layoffs and increasingly precarious working conditions for workers in the sector.

What information must a client provide to open a bank account in Guatemala?

To open a bank account in Guatemala, a customer generally must provide: <ul><li>Valid identification document, such as a personal identification card or passport.</li><li>Proof of residence, such as a utility bill </li><li>Information on economic activity and origin of funds. </li><li>Personal or commercial references in some cases. </li></ul>Requirements may vary depending on the institution, but these are common in the KYC process.

How do Costa Rican authorities supervise and regulate the implementation of KYC in financial institutions?

The General Superintendency of Financial Entities (SUGEF) in Costa Rica plays a key role in supervising and regulating the implementation of KYC, ensuring compliance with regulations and sanctioning non-compliance.
